> I've been asked recently to provide quick and dirty websites for folks.
>
> Although I've forwarded most of these requests to others with more
> skill, I was wondering if there is anyone out there using a tool that
> can do that.
>
> I know there are plenty of hosters that have online tools, but in this
> specific case, I'm looking for a tool that I can use on my Linux box
> that would create a reasonable looking website without too much time in.
>
> Anyone know of such a thing?
>
More complex sites:
Plone
Drupal
Wordpress
Not complex sites:
oswd.org templates
server side includes
ftp/scponly access to data
